## Releases

Hey support folks — quick notes on ProfileMesh shard releases. Each release re-balances user-profile shards gradually, so don't panic if a lookup lands on a stale shard for a few minutes post-deploy; it self-heals. Release bundles are published twice a month and are always signed. If a customer asks you to verify a bundle they downloaded, walk them through the checksum step using the public signing key below.

deploy key for kawif-bageg: bky19_YQNdHDgpaLxUNwPoHm9

Welcome to on-call for the Glimmerpane design system! Our snapshot tests live in the `snapcheck` suite and run on every merge to main. If a UI component changes visually, the diff bot flags it — usually it's an intentional tweak, so just approve the new baseline. If it's 2am and snapshots are failing across the board, it's almost always a font-loading race, not your problem. To unlock the baseline store and re-approve snapshots in bulk, use the recovery passphrase below.

recovery phrase for tahag-taguf: wenix-caswyn

[ ] Verify timezone handling in report exports (Ledgerline v4.2). All exported CSV and PDF reports must render timestamps in the requesting user's configured timezone, not server UTC. Confirm that DST boundary cases (late October, late March) produce no duplicated or skipped hour rows. Also confirm the export worker rejects timezone strings that fail validation rather than silently defaulting. Audit logs should record the resolved zone per export. The candidate build for sign-off is listed below.

build token for fahap-yagag: htk3_d09

- [ ] Goods lift orientation (night shift). The goods lift at Marden Depot is reserved for deliveries only — never use it for personal trips, even after hours. Check the lift car is empty of pallets before sending it down. Log any stuck doors in the shift book for the morning crew. The lift call panel accepts the override code below.

staff pass of kawip-hawef = bdg-QLP-2